目的研究白色念珠菌引起机体系统感染后免疫功能的变化。方法收集2008年6月至2011年12月对血液细菌培养白色念珠菌阳性的患者立即进行血清IgA、IgG、IgM的检测,以及血清细胞因子(IFN-r)和细胞因子(IL-4)的检测,并于10日后对患者上述指标进行复检,并且以正常人的上述指标检测结果为对照,以观察白色念珠菌感染后所引起的机体免疫功能的变化。结果血液细菌培养白色念珠菌阳性的患者初次血清IgA、IgG、IgM的检测结果为:(2.46±1.53)g/L、(11.36±3.14)g/L、(1.15±0.48)g/L,正常对照组相应指标检测结果为:(2.45±1.62)g/L、(10.43±2.58)g/L、(1.11±0.64)g/L,两组数据无统计学意义,P值分别为0.99、0.20、0.77。患者10 d后血清IgA、IgG、IgM的检测结果为(1.92±1.21)g/L、(10.89±3.84)g/L、(1.35±0.64)g/L,和对照组相比无统计学意义,P值分别为0.12、0.54、0.45。白色念珠菌感染者前后两次血清IgA、IgG、IgM的检测结果的显著性检验无统计学意义,P值分别为0.11、0.28、0.27。患者血清IFN-r和IL-4的初次检测结果为:IFN-r(135.17±34.06)pg/mL,IL-4(229.09±50.63)pg/mL。对照组:IFN-r(87.69±18.69)pg/mL,IL-4(221.47±48.37)pg/mL,患者组和对照组的血清IFN-r之间有显著差别,P值为0.00,患者组和对照组血清IL-4之间无统计学意义,P值为0.540。感染10 d后患者血清IFN-r和IL-4的检测结果为:IFN-r(130.17±38.89)pg/mL,IL-4(237.28±51.21)pg/mL,与对照组相比,IFN-r检测结果两组间有明显差异,P=0.001,IL-4检测结果与对照组检测结果之间无统计学意义,P=0.382。白色念珠菌感染者前后两次血清IFN-r和IL-4的检测结果无统计学意义,P值分别为0.58、0.51。结论白色念珠菌引起机体系统感染后免疫功能的变化以细胞免疫为主,体液免疫没有发生明显的变化。
Objective To study immune function changes of patients after blood system infection by Candida albicans.Methods Immediately detected serum IgA and IgG and IgM and IFN-r and IL-4 level after confirmed patients infected by candida albicans through blood culture,and again detected the above patients serum target after ten days,then study immune function changes of pateint after blood system infection by candida calbicans through comparing the above patients’detected results with healthy person’.Results Serum IgA and IgG and IgM level of patients infected by candida albicans are(2.46±1.53)g/L and(11.36±3.14)g/L and(1.15±0.48)g/L,serum IgA and IgG and IgM level of healthy people are respectively(2.45±1.62)g/L and(10.43±2.58)g/L and(1.11±0.64)g/L,there are not evidently different between serum IgA and IgG and IgM level of patients infected by candida albicans and healthy people(P>0.05).The serum IgA and IgG and IgM level of patients after ten days were respectively(1.92±1.21)g/L and(10.89±3.84)g/L and(1.35±0.64)g/L,the level was not evidently different with healthy people(P>0.05)and there were not evidently different between two times immunoglobulin level of patients(P>0.05).The serum IFN-r and IL-4 level of patients were repectively(135.17±34.06)pg/mL and(229.09±50.63)pg/mL,serum IFN-r and IL-4 level of healthy people were repectively(87.69±18.69)pg/mL and(221.47±48.37)pg/mL,serum IFN-r level of patients were evidently different with healthy people(P<0.05),serum IL-4 level of patients were not evidently different with healthy people(P>0.05).The serum IFN-r and IL-4 level of patients were repectively(130.17±38.89)pg/mL and(237.28±51.21)pg/mL after ten days,the IFN-r level is evidently different with thealthy people(P<0.05),the IL-4 level was not evidently different with healthy people(P>0.05).There were not evidently different between two times serum IFN-r and IL-4 level of patients(P>0.05).Conclusion Cellular immunity is mainly caused after patients was infected by candida albicans rather than humoral immunity.
